Версия: 6.x
burger close
Класс RuleIfFeedback
Граф наследования:RuleIfFeedback:
AbstractIfRule

Открытые члены

 getId ()
 
 getTitle ()
 
 getLinkedTypeId ()
 
 getOperationsByType ($type)
 
 getActions ()
 
 getParams ($action=null)
 
 getAvailableActions ()
 
 getReplaceVarTitles ()
 
 getReplaceValues ($entity)
 
 getFormId ()
 
- Открытые члены унаследованные от AbstractIfRule
 getId ()
 
 getTitle ()
 
 getOperationsByType ($type)
 
 getEntity ()
 
 getOperation ()
 
 getRule ()
 
 getThenRule ()
 
 getActions ()
 
 getParams ($action=null)
 
 getReplaceVarTitles ()
 
 getReplaceValues ($entity)
 
 getLinkedTypeId ()
 
 getAvailableActions ()
 
 getParamValues ($param)
 
 getNodeType ($key)
 
 isMultiple ($key)
 
 getTplFolder ()
 
 initThenRule ()
 
 compareParams ()
 

Дополнительные унаследованные члены

- Открытые статические члены унаследованные от AbstractIfRule
static getAllIfRules ()
 
static getClassesByMode ($mode)
 
static getMode ()
 
static getClassById ($id)
 
static getSupportsEvent ()
 
static match ($item, $if_class, $params)
 
- Поля данных унаследованные от AbstractIfRule
const MODE_EVENT = 'event'
 
const MODE_CRON = 'cron'
 
- Защищенные члены унаследованные от AbstractIfRule
 modifyParamsItem ($item)
 
 calculateObjectHash ($object, $values)
 
- Защищенные данные унаследованные от AbstractIfRule
 $entity
 
 $operation
 
 $rule
 
 $then_rule
 
- Статические защищенные данные унаследованные от AbstractIfRule
static string $mode = self::MODE_EVENT
 

Методы

getActions ( )

Возвращает действия, которые будут учитываться при выполнении условия

Возвращает
array
getAvailableActions ( )

Воздращает доступные для условия действия

Возвращает
array
getFormId ( )

Возвращает формы

Возвращает
array
getId ( )

Возвращает идентификатор класса условия

Возвращает
string
getLinkedTypeId ( )

Возвращает тип связи для объекта

Возвращает
string
getOperationsByType (   $type)

Возвращает массив действий над объектом по типу

Возвращает
array
getParams (   $action = null)

Возвращает дополнительные параметры, которые будут учитываться при выполнении условия

Возвращает
array
getReplaceValues (   $entity)

Возвращает значения переменных, которые будут заменены в строковых полях задачи.

Возвращает
array
getReplaceVarTitles ( )

Возвращает переменные, которые будут заменены в строковых полях задачи.

Возвращает
array
getTitle ( )

Возвращает публичное название класса условия

Возвращает
string